The entrance edge takes repeated loading and must meet the highway neatly. Existing setts, kerbs and channels are checked for stability.
We measure the space cars actually need rather than following an arbitrary outline. This helps resolve borders, paths and turning points.
Old tarmac or concrete can only stay when it is sound and suitably shaped. Movement below resin is likely to show through later.
Survey and preparation
We inspect the complete driveway or garden area, including points where it meets doors, walls, planting and public access. Levels are taken, drainage is reviewed and the base is checked for cracking or soft sections. We also establish where materials can be delivered and mixed.
Those observations decide the preparation method. The quotation confirms removal, base construction, repairs, drainage and edges before naming the resin finish. If there is more than one responsible option, we explain the difference instead of hiding it behind a single short description.

A retained border may be possible if it is secure, at the correct level and suitable for the finished design. Loose setts or weak edges need rebuilding. We test the edge during the survey and state any reuse in the quotation.
Yes, when excavation is required. The written scope explains removal, disposal and the proposed replacement base rather than listing resin alone. If a sound existing surface can be prepared and overlaid, that alternative is described so the difference is transparent.
Resin bound surfaces have a textured aggregate finish, and the system can be specified for appropriate grip. No outdoor surface remains maintenance-free in algae, leaves or ice. We discuss use, slope and cleaning so the selected finish is suitable for the setting.
